What Does Preventive Health Coverage Mean in Health Insurance?


Preventive health coverage in health insurance refers to routine check-ups and medical screenings to detect potential issues early. It is often covered under a standard health insurance plan as part of preventive screenings, with either the full cost or a specified portion of the expenses covered.


However, the extent of coverage depends on the policy terms. Also, check the latest list of tests included in your package.


What are the Benefits of Preventive Health Coverage in Health Insurance?


If your insurance offers preventive health check-up facilities once a year, you can avail a multitude of benefits. They include:


1. Timely Prevention


Detecting health issues early through preventive health check-ups allows one to take the necessary steps before a condition develops or worsens.


2. Financial Benefits


These check-ups under medical insurance can also provide financial relief since you do not need to pay upfront.


Suppose you need to pay from your pocket because the expenses go beyond your covered limit, or you choose tests outside the insurer's package. Then you may qualify for deductions under Section 80D of the Income Tax Act.


Moreover, it is up to ₹5,000 deduction as per the Income Tax Department, Ministry of Finance, Government of India.


3. Peace of Mind


Annual health check-ups offer reassurance. It eliminates the surprise of discovering that a disease is developing in your body. They ensure that any concerns are identified and managed at the right time.


Types of Preventive Health Coverage in Health Insurance


Most insurers offer this coverage through several packages. Generally, you can find pathological test packages that you can avail from the comfort of your home. For other screenings, you may need to visit one of your insurer’s tied-up diagnostic centres or in-network providers.


Each package comes with a list of health tests. Insurers curate these lists considering different health needs. In general, they cover essential tests such as:



  1. Blood sugar

  2. Lipid profile

  3. Vitamin levels

  4. CBC (Complete Blood Count)

  5. Liver and kidney function

  6. Thyroid tests

  7. Diabetes profile


Things to Know About Preventive Health Coverage in Health Insurance


1. Check the Payment Procedure


Check whether the benefit is available on a cashless basis or through reimbursement.


2. Be Aware of the List of Tests


Review the list of tests included in the preventive health check-up package for your policy.


3. Understand the Waiting Period


Some policies include waiting periods or specific eligibility conditions. Understand the terms in advance so you can avail the benefit when you need it.
